Summary
Eric discusses how success can weigh on you more than failure and reintroduces the concept of the "parasite," a pattern that affects successful men who feel restless despite their achievements. This parasite, which feeds on effort and adapts to improvement, attaches early in the success journey and becomes a structural attachment, turning discipline into compulsion and standards into micromanagement. He also emphasizes that this issue is not about motivation or strategy but a structural attachment that needs to be unhooked, not overpowered. Listen In!
